시가총액: $2.8337T 0.60%
거래량(24시간): $136.9463B -23.72%
공포와 탐욕 지수:

28 - 두려움

  • 시가총액: $2.8337T 0.60%
  • 거래량(24시간): $136.9463B -23.72%
  • 공포와 탐욕 지수:
  • 시가총액: $2.8337T 0.60%
암호화
주제
암호화
소식
cryptostopics
비디오
최고 암호화

언어 선택

언어 선택

통화 선택

암호화
주제
암호화
소식
cryptostopics
비디오

블록체인 오라클은 무엇이며 실제 데이터를 어떻게 체인에 가져오나요?

Blockchain oracles bridge smart contracts with real-world data, enabling decentralized apps to securely access off-chain information like prices, weather, or election results.

2025/11/16 15:19

블록체인 오라클 이해

1. 블록체인 오라클은 스마트 계약을 외부 데이터 소스와 연결하는 제3자 서비스입니다. 스마트 계약은 격리된 환경 내에서 작동하며 기본적으로 네트워크 외부의 정보에 액세스할 수 없습니다. 오라클은 분산 애플리케이션에서 사용할 수 있도록 실제 데이터를 블록체인에 가져오고 검증하고 전달함으로써 이러한 격차를 해소합니다.

2. 이러한 오라클은 신뢰할 수 있는 중개자 역할을 합니다. 날씨 API, 금융 시장 피드, 스포츠 결과 또는 IoT 장치와 같은 오프체인 시스템에서 데이터를 검색합니다. 검색된 데이터는 형식화되어 스마트 계약에서 사전 정의된 작업을 트리거하는 블록체인으로 전송됩니다.

3. 오라클은 방향성과 신뢰 모델에 따라 분류될 수 있습니다. 인바운드 오라클은 외부 데이터를 블록체인으로 가져오고, 아웃바운드 오라클은 블록체인에서 외부 시스템으로 데이터를 보냅니다. 중앙 집중식 또는 분산형일 수도 있습니다. 중앙 집중식 오라클은 단일 소스에 의존하여 잠재적인 실패 지점을 초래하는 반면, 분산식 오라클은 안정성을 높이기 위해 여러 소스의 데이터를 집계합니다.

4. 스마트 계약 실행의 무결성은 오라클 입력의 정확성에 크게 좌우됩니다. 오라클이 조작되거나 잘못된 데이터를 전달하는 경우 결과적인 계약 동작에도 결함이 발생합니다. 이는 신뢰가 없는 환경에서 외부 데이터 공급자를 신뢰하는 것과 관련된 위험을 강조하는 "오라클 문제"로 알려져 있습니다.

5. 이러한 문제를 해결하기 위해 Chainlink, Band Protocol 및 API3와 같은 주목할만한 oracle 솔루션이 등장했습니다. 데이터 신뢰성과 변조 방지를 보장하기 위해 암호화 증명, 평판 시스템 및 경제적 인센티브를 구현합니다.

오라클이 실제 데이터를 온체인으로 제공하는 방법

1. 스마트 계약에 외부 데이터가 필요한 경우 지정된 오라클에 요청을 보냅니다. 이 요청은 Bitcoin의 현재 가격(USD) 또는 선거 결과와 같이 필요한 데이터 유형을 지정합니다.

2. 오라클은 쿼리를 수신하고 하나 이상의 오프체인 데이터 소스에 액세스합니다. 웹 API, 데이터베이스 또는 센서 네트워크에서 정보를 가져올 수 있습니다. 조작을 최소화하기 위해 분산형 오라클은 여러 독립적인 소스에서 데이터를 수집하고 집계 기술을 사용하는 경우가 많습니다.

3. 데이터를 블록체인으로 전송하기 전에 오라클은 합의 메커니즘이나 암호화 검증을 사용하여 데이터를 검증합니다. 일부 오라클은 토큰을 담보로 스테이킹하는 노드 운영자를 고용하여 페널티 시스템을 통해 정직한 보고를 장려합니다.

4. 검증이 완료되면 오라클은 데이터를 블록체인이 읽을 수 있는 구조로 포맷하고 이를 트랜잭션으로 제출합니다. 이 트랜잭션은 변경 불가능한 원장의 일부가 되어 요청하는 스마트 계약이 데이터에 액세스할 수 있게 해줍니다.

5. 그런 다음 스마트 계약은 새로 사용 가능한 데이터를 기반으로 논리를 실행합니다. 예를 들어, 분산형 보험 정책에서 오라클이 항공편이 지연되었다고 보고하면 계약은 영향을 받은 승객에게 자동으로 보상을 지급합니다.

암호화폐 생태계에서 블록체인 오라클의 사용 사례

1. 탈중앙화 금융(DeFi) 플랫폼은 대출, 대출, 거래에 대한 자산 가치를 결정하기 위해 가격 오라클에 크게 의존합니다. Aave 및 컴파운드와 같은 프로토콜은 오라클을 사용하여 담보 비율을 모니터링하고 필요한 경우 청산을 실행합니다.

2. Augur 및 Polymarket과 같은 예측 시장은 오라클을 활용하여 실제 결과를 기반으로 베팅을 정산합니다. 오라클은 정치 후보가 선거에서 승리했는지 또는 회사가 분기별 매출 목표를 달성했는지 확인하여 투명하고 자동화된 지급을 가능하게 합니다.

3. 보험 dApp은 오라클을 사용하여 청구를 확인합니다. 농작물 보험 계약은 기상 관측소의 기상 데이터에 따라 실행될 수 있는 반면, 여행 보험은 항공사 지연 데이터베이스에 따라 달라질 수 있습니다.

4. 공급망 애플리케이션은 오라클을 통합하여 제품 진위 여부를 검증합니다. 센서와 물류 추적기는 배송 데이터를 블록체인에 입력하여 소비자가 상품의 원산지와 여행 경로를 확인할 수 있도록 합니다.

5. 게임 및 NFT 플랫폼은 동적 콘텐츠 생성을 위해 오라클을 활용합니다. 무작위성 오라클은 전리품 상자 배포 또는 경쟁 게임 결과에 대해 입증 가능한 공정한 난수를 제공합니다.

오라클은 스마트 계약이 현실 세계와 안전하고 안정적으로 상호 작용할 수 있도록 하는 블록체인 공간의 필수 인프라입니다.

자주 묻는 질문

분산형 오라클이 중앙 집중형 오라클보다 더 안전한 이유는 무엇입니까? 분산형 오라클은 여러 독립 노드에서 정보를 소싱하여 단일 장애 지점 및 데이터 조작의 위험을 줄입니다. 이러한 노드 간의 합의는 단일 공급자에 의존하는 것에 비해 더 높은 데이터 무결성을 보장합니다.

오라클 자체가 해킹되거나 손상될 수 있나요? 예, 오라클은 잠재적인 공격 벡터입니다. 공격자가 중앙 집중식 오라클에 대한 통제권을 얻거나 데이터 소스를 조작하는 경우 스마트 계약에 잘못된 정보를 제공할 수 있습니다. 이는 암호화로 보호되고 분산된 오라클 네트워크를 사용하는 것의 중요성을 강조합니다.

경제적 인센티브는 오라클 네트워크를 어떻게 보호합니까? 많은 오라클 네트워크에서는 노드 운영자가 암호화폐를 담보로 스테이킹하도록 요구합니다. 부정확하거나 사기성 데이터를 제출하면 삭감 메커니즘을 통해 지분을 잃습니다. 정직한 참가자는 보상을 받고 자신의 관심을 네트워크 보안에 맞춰 조정합니다.

모든 유형의 실제 데이터가 오라클을 통한 온체인 전달에 적합합니까? 비용, 대기 시간, 검증 가능성 제약으로 인해 모든 데이터가 이상적인 것은 아닙니다. 높은 빈도의 데이터 업데이트는 온체인에서 비용이 많이 들 수 있습니다. 또한 주관적이거나 검증할 수 없는 정보로 인해 문제가 발생합니다. 오라클은 신뢰할 수 있는 소스에서 얻은 객관적이고 기계 판독 가능하며 타임스탬프가 지정된 데이터로 가장 잘 작동합니다.

부인 성명:info@kdj.com

제공된 정보는 거래 조언이 아닙니다. kdj.com은 이 기사에 제공된 정보를 기반으로 이루어진 투자에 대해 어떠한 책임도 지지 않습니다. 암호화폐는 변동성이 매우 높으므로 철저한 조사 후 신중하게 투자하는 것이 좋습니다!

본 웹사이트에 사용된 내용이 귀하의 저작권을 침해한다고 판단되는 경우, 즉시 당사(info@kdj.com)로 연락주시면 즉시 삭제하도록 하겠습니다.

관련 지식

Bybit에서 처음으로 암호화폐 계약을 거래하는 방법은 무엇인가요?

Bybit에서 처음으로 암호화폐 계약을 거래하는 방법은 무엇인가요?

2026-02-01 04:00:10

Bybit 계정 설정 1. Bybit 공식 홈페이지에 접속하여 홈페이지 우측 상단의 '회원가입' 버튼을 클릭하세요. 2. 유효한 이메일 주소를 입력하고 대문자, 소문자, 숫자, 특수문자를 포함하는 강력한 비밀번호를 만드세요. 3. CAPTCHA 인증을 완...

슬리피지가 낮고 레버리지가 높은 암호화폐 계약을 찾는 방법은 무엇입니까?

슬리피지가 낮고 레버리지가 높은 암호화폐 계약을 찾는 방법은 무엇입니까?

2026-02-01 04:19:41

활용도가 높은 암호화폐 계약 찾기 1. 거래자들은 종종 분산형 및 중앙형 거래소에서 50배 이상의 레버리지를 제공하는 영구 선물 계약을 검색합니다. Binance, Bybit 및 OKX는 격리 마진 모드에서 최대 125배의 레버리지로 여러 BTC, ETH 및 SOL 쌍...

LayerZero 계약으로 크로스체인 메시지를 실행하는 방법은 무엇입니까?

LayerZero 계약으로 크로스체인 메시지를 실행하는 방법은 무엇입니까?

2026-01-18 13:19:39

LayerZero 아키텍처 이해 1. LayerZero는 신뢰할 수 있는 중개자나 래핑된 자산에 의존하지 않고 블록체인 간의 통신을 가능하게 하는 경량의 무허가 상호 운용성 프로토콜로 작동합니다. 2. 각 체인에 배포된 Ultra Light Node(ULN)를 활용하여...

안전한 서명 검증을 위해 EIP-712를 구현하는 방법은 무엇입니까?

안전한 서명 검증을 위해 EIP-712를 구현하는 방법은 무엇입니까?

2026-01-20 22:20:26

EIP-712 개요 및 핵심 목적 1. EIP-712는 이더리움 애플리케이션에서 형식화된 구조화된 데이터 해싱 및 서명에 대한 표준을 정의합니다. 2. 서명 요청 시 원시 16진수 문자열 대신 사람이 읽을 수 있는 도메인 및 메시지 필드를 지갑에 표시할 수 있습니다. ...

새로운 계약과 상호 작용하여 에어드랍 자격을 얻는 방법은 무엇입니까?

새로운 계약과 상호 작용하여 에어드랍 자격을 얻는 방법은 무엇입니까?

2026-01-24 21:00:23

계약 상호 작용 요구 사항 이해 1. 대부분의 에어드롭 캠페인은 Ethereum, Arbitrum 또는 Base와 같은 지원되는 블록체인에 배포된 스마트 계약과의 직접적인 상호 작용을 요구합니다. 2. 상호 작용에는 일반적으로 dApp 인터페이스에 연결된 지갑을 사용하...

보안 경고에 대한 스마트 계약을 모니터링하는 방법은 무엇입니까?

보안 경고에 대한 스마트 계약을 모니터링하는 방법은 무엇입니까?

2026-01-21 07:59:57

온체인 모니터링 도구 1. Etherscan 및 Blockscout와 같은 블록체인 탐색기를 사용하면 계약 바이트 코드, 트랜잭션 로그 및 내부 호출을 실시간으로 검사할 수 있습니다. 2. 온체인 데이터를 신뢰하기 전에 계약 확인 상태를 확인해야 합니다. 확인되지 않은...

Bybit에서 처음으로 암호화폐 계약을 거래하는 방법은 무엇인가요?

Bybit에서 처음으로 암호화폐 계약을 거래하는 방법은 무엇인가요?

2026-02-01 04:00:10

Bybit 계정 설정 1. Bybit 공식 홈페이지에 접속하여 홈페이지 우측 상단의 '회원가입' 버튼을 클릭하세요. 2. 유효한 이메일 주소를 입력하고 대문자, 소문자, 숫자, 특수문자를 포함하는 강력한 비밀번호를 만드세요. 3. CAPTCHA 인증을 완...

슬리피지가 낮고 레버리지가 높은 암호화폐 계약을 찾는 방법은 무엇입니까?

슬리피지가 낮고 레버리지가 높은 암호화폐 계약을 찾는 방법은 무엇입니까?

2026-02-01 04:19:41

활용도가 높은 암호화폐 계약 찾기 1. 거래자들은 종종 분산형 및 중앙형 거래소에서 50배 이상의 레버리지를 제공하는 영구 선물 계약을 검색합니다. Binance, Bybit 및 OKX는 격리 마진 모드에서 최대 125배의 레버리지로 여러 BTC, ETH 및 SOL 쌍...

LayerZero 계약으로 크로스체인 메시지를 실행하는 방법은 무엇입니까?

LayerZero 계약으로 크로스체인 메시지를 실행하는 방법은 무엇입니까?

2026-01-18 13:19:39

LayerZero 아키텍처 이해 1. LayerZero는 신뢰할 수 있는 중개자나 래핑된 자산에 의존하지 않고 블록체인 간의 통신을 가능하게 하는 경량의 무허가 상호 운용성 프로토콜로 작동합니다. 2. 각 체인에 배포된 Ultra Light Node(ULN)를 활용하여...

안전한 서명 검증을 위해 EIP-712를 구현하는 방법은 무엇입니까?

안전한 서명 검증을 위해 EIP-712를 구현하는 방법은 무엇입니까?

2026-01-20 22:20:26

EIP-712 개요 및 핵심 목적 1. EIP-712는 이더리움 애플리케이션에서 형식화된 구조화된 데이터 해싱 및 서명에 대한 표준을 정의합니다. 2. 서명 요청 시 원시 16진수 문자열 대신 사람이 읽을 수 있는 도메인 및 메시지 필드를 지갑에 표시할 수 있습니다. ...

새로운 계약과 상호 작용하여 에어드랍 자격을 얻는 방법은 무엇입니까?

새로운 계약과 상호 작용하여 에어드랍 자격을 얻는 방법은 무엇입니까?

2026-01-24 21:00:23

계약 상호 작용 요구 사항 이해 1. 대부분의 에어드롭 캠페인은 Ethereum, Arbitrum 또는 Base와 같은 지원되는 블록체인에 배포된 스마트 계약과의 직접적인 상호 작용을 요구합니다. 2. 상호 작용에는 일반적으로 dApp 인터페이스에 연결된 지갑을 사용하...

보안 경고에 대한 스마트 계약을 모니터링하는 방법은 무엇입니까?

보안 경고에 대한 스마트 계약을 모니터링하는 방법은 무엇입니까?

2026-01-21 07:59:57

온체인 모니터링 도구 1. Etherscan 및 Blockscout와 같은 블록체인 탐색기를 사용하면 계약 바이트 코드, 트랜잭션 로그 및 내부 호출을 실시간으로 검사할 수 있습니다. 2. 온체인 데이터를 신뢰하기 전에 계약 확인 상태를 확인해야 합니다. 확인되지 않은...

모든 기사 보기

User not found or password invalid

Your input is correct